Abstract :
The eXtreme Programming (XP) software development methodology has received considerable industrial attention in recent years. As a methodology which is highly responsive to customer´s changing requirements, XP has been widely used in Web application developing process. As a key characteristic of XP, Test-Driven Development(TDD) can be used for refactoring the new code and ensuring the quality of the Web application software. At the same time, Web application make use of the layered approach to enhance the scalability. As to the guideline of using the layered approach with XP methodology, no studies has been found so far. Based on the layered approach, this paper proposes a Test-Driven model for Web application. What´s more, this paper identifies what kinds of test should be done in every layer of the Web application.
